This helps reducing our build-time checks for feature support in the
available Linux kernel headers. And it helps users that do not have
sufficiently recent headers installed on their build machine.
Header upstate is triggered via 'make update-linux-headers', optionally
specifying a kernel directory as source via 'LINUX='.
---
I'm sure this is not yet perfect from technical POV (e.g. the patch to
Makefile.target looks like a hack to me, better ideas welcome),
therefore RFC and no SOB. But it should demonstrate the plan. The
workflow for adding a new KVM feature support would be first a 'make
update-linux-header LINUX=/my/local/linux' + git commit, and then the
commit of the kvm, vhost, whatever changes.
A patch to actually add the result of the header update would be posted
separately. Same for the now possible massive cleanups of kvm sources.
